Brawl Stars China reimagines Supercell’s global hit for Chinese players, blending fast-paced 3v3 battles with localized flair. Dive into vibrant arenas featuring Chinese cultural themes, exclusive heroes like "Dragon Warrior Ling," and seasonal events tied to Lunar New Year and Mid-Autumn Festival. Optimized servers, Tencent social integration, and streamlined controls make this MOBA spinoff a thrilling, culturally resonant experience.
Features of Brawl Stars China:
1. Cultural-Themed Arenas: Battle in redesigned maps like "Forbidden Temple" and "Terracotta Battlefield."
2. Exclusive Heroes/Skins: Unlock China-only characters (e.g., martial arts-inspired brawlers) and traditional dynasty-themed skins.
3. Festival Events: Earn limited rewards via lantern riddles, dragon dances, and mooncake-collection mini-games.
4. Tencent Social Hub: Invite friends via WeChat/QQ, share replays, and join guilds with clan-exclusive quests.
5. Regional Ranked Mode: Compete in China-specific leaderboards with unique badges and live-stream integration.
6. Simplified Progression: Free legendary brawler unlocks for beginners and double XP weekends.
Advantages of Brawl Stars China:
1. Low-Latency Servers: Dedicated mainland servers reduce lag for smoother 60fps gameplay.
2. Cultural Familiarity: Lore and visuals resonate with local traditions, enhancing immersion.
3. Strict Anti-Cheat: Tencent’s FairPlay system minimizes bots and exploits.
4. Free Content Updates: Monthly festival events and hero rotations keep gameplay fresh.
5. Youth Protection Mode: Playtime limits and spend caps comply with China’s gaming regulations.
Disadvantages of Brawl Stars China:
1. APK Dependency: Unofficial downloads risk malware; no Google Play/iOS support outside China.
2. Language Barrier: Mandarin-only interface limits global player accessibility.
3. Regional Lock: Progress doesn’t transfer to/from the global version.
4. Overpowered Skins: Paid skins occasionally grant subtle stat boosts, affecting balance.
Development Team:
Co-developed by Supercell and Tencent Games, leveraging Tencent’s localized MOBA expertise (Honor of Kings) and Supercell’s global design framework. Tencent’s Shenzhen team integrated Chinese cultural assets and compliance features, while Supercell optimized core mechanics.
Competitive Products:
1. Honor of Kings
- *Pros*: Massive player base, deep lore, esports dominance.
- *Cons*: Steep learning curve; less accessible casual gameplay.
2. Arena of Valor
- *Pros*: Cross-region play; diverse hero roster.
- *Cons*: Inconsistent updates; weaker anti-cheat.
3. Genshin Impact
- *Pros*: Stunning visuals; open-world exploration.
- *Cons*: Heavy hardware requirements; lacks PvP focus.
Market Performance:
Ranked #4 in China’s iOS Action category, with 8M+ downloads post-launch. Holds a 4.3/5 rating on TapTap, praised for cultural touches but critiqued for aggressive cosmetic monetization. User reviews highlight addictive team battles but note server crashes during peak festival events.
